In the forging operation, fullering is done to
  • a)
    draw out the material
  • b)
    bend the material
  • c)
    upset the material
  • d)
    extrude the material
Correct answer is option 'A'. Can you explain this answer?

Fullering is performed by a pair of concave dies and in this materia! moves away from the centre this decreases the size of a slab.

Fullering in Forging Operation

Fullering is a forging operation that is used to draw out the material. It is a process that is used to create a groove or a depression in the metal workpiece. This groove is then used as a guide for the hammer or the press to shape the metal into the desired shape. Fullering is an important operation in forging as it helps to control the shape of the metal and ensure that it is drawn out evenly.

Steps in Fullering Operation

The following are the steps involved in fullering operation:

1. Heating the metal: The metal is heated to a temperature that is suitable for forging.

2. Placing the metal on the anvil: The metal is placed on the anvil and held in place with tongs.

3. Striking the metal: The hammer or press is used to strike the metal at the point where the fullering is required.

4. Creating the groove: The hammer or press is used to create a groove or depression in the metal. This groove is then used as a guide for shaping the metal.

5. Shaping the metal: The metal is then shaped by hammering or pressing it into the desired shape.

6. Repeating the process: The process is repeated until the metal is drawn out to the desired size and shape.

Conclusion

Fullering is a forging operation that is used to draw out the material. It is an important process in forging as it helps to control the shape of the metal and ensure that it is drawn out evenly. The process involves heating the metal, striking it with a hammer or press, creating a groove or depression in the metal, and shaping the metal into the desired shape.
